Supportnet / Forum / Datenbanken
parametereingabe Datum
Frage
Hallo
Vielleicht kann mir jemand helfen. Ich habe in meinem Formular (Access) eine Berichtsvorschau mit Parameterwert. Weiss aber nicht wie ich einen Datumwert eingebe..z.b. alles was nach dem 01.11.2005 ist soll er anzeigen, macht er aber nicht, entweder steht dann nur der 01.11.2005 oder #Fehler#.
Vielen Dank im Voraus
Antwort 1 von Roadrunner90
Hi,
wenn du alles ab dem 1.11. willst mußt >= benutzen
Gruß Rudolf
wenn du alles ab dem 1.11. willst mußt >= benutzen
Gruß Rudolf
Antwort 2 von Diavolo1
hallo rudolf
erstmal danke, nur klappt es leider nicht. wahrscheinlich habe ich etwas falsch. im abfrage-entwurf habe ich bei *Datum* unter *Kriterien*, Wie [Geben Sie das Datum ein]. Ist das falsch oder was muss ich genau in der Berichtsvorschau im Parameterfenster eingeben.
Dankend im voraus
erstmal danke, nur klappt es leider nicht. wahrscheinlich habe ich etwas falsch. im abfrage-entwurf habe ich bei *Datum* unter *Kriterien*, Wie [Geben Sie das Datum ein]. Ist das falsch oder was muss ich genau in der Berichtsvorschau im Parameterfenster eingeben.
Dankend im voraus
Antwort 3 von Roadrunner90
Hi,
ich hab mal eine Abfrage gebaut die sieht so aus:
1. gewünschte Felder
2. zusätzlich Feld (nicht aus Tabelle) als "Datum kurz " definiert
3. Kriterium für Abfrage-Datum >=[zusätzliches Feld]
beim ausführen der Abfrage wird dann der Parameter [zusätzliches Feld] abgefragt und in der Form tt.mm.jjjj
eingegeben
Sollte auch bei dir so funktionieren.
Gruß Rudolf
ich hab mal eine Abfrage gebaut die sieht so aus:
1. gewünschte Felder
2. zusätzlich Feld (nicht aus Tabelle) als "Datum kurz " definiert
3. Kriterium für Abfrage-Datum >=[zusätzliches Feld]
beim ausführen der Abfrage wird dann der Parameter [zusätzliches Feld] abgefragt und in der Form tt.mm.jjjj
eingegeben
Sollte auch bei dir so funktionieren.
Gruß Rudolf
Antwort 4 von Flintstone
@Diavolo1,
nur so eine Idee und auch nicht ausprobiert:
Wie wäre es, wenn du den Dezimalwert des Datums als Parameter benutzt?
01.11.2005 = 38657 nach 1900-Datumswert, also der Tag 38657 seit dem 01.01.1900 =1. (Beim 1904-Datumswert hat übrigens der 02.01.1904 den Wert 1.)
Wenns so nicht klappt, schlag mich bitte nicht.
Gruß
Fred
nur so eine Idee und auch nicht ausprobiert:
Wie wäre es, wenn du den Dezimalwert des Datums als Parameter benutzt?
01.11.2005 = 38657 nach 1900-Datumswert, also der Tag 38657 seit dem 01.01.1900 =1. (Beim 1904-Datumswert hat übrigens der 02.01.1904 den Wert 1.)
Wenns so nicht klappt, schlag mich bitte nicht.
Gruß
Fred
Antwort 5 von Diavolo1
ich danke fürs helfen aber das klappt leider nicht
lieben gruss
lieben gruss
Antwort 6 von Roadrunner90
Hi,
geht nicht - gibt´s nicht.
schick mir mal den Abfrageentwurf
geht nicht - gibt´s nicht.
schick mir mal den Abfrageentwurf
Antwort 7 von Diavolo1
lieber rudolf...falls du aus österreich bist..kann ich dir irgendwie vorher meine nummer oder umgekehrt zu kommen lassen zwecks tel ?
gruss diavolo
gruss diavolo
Antwort 8 von Roadrunner90
Hi diavolo,
bin nicht aus Österreich. Wenn du dich hier registrierst kann ich dir per pager meine mailadresse geben oder hast du evtl. ICQ?
bin nicht aus Österreich. Wenn du dich hier registrierst kann ich dir per pager meine mailadresse geben oder hast du evtl. ICQ?
Antwort 9 von Diavolo1
falls du msn hast,.... diavolo_2004@hotmail.com

